Honesty and Integrity Respect and Caring for Others Openness and Collaboration Individual and Team Accountability Passion and Purpose We are seeking to add a motivated, knowledgeable, self-starter with a positive attitude to join our team as an EHS Technician in the Monett, MO area. The position supports environmental and safety programs and is an advocate for employee health and safety. If you are interested in joining a growing team that partners with the business to create fun and play in the playground and recreational industry, then this could be your next career opportunity!Responsibilities include:
Research, read and interpret applicable regulatory requirements by utilizing applicable state and federal regulatory resources and other tools to ensure compliance. Conducts training by utilizing in-house and external resources to educate new hires and other employees on workplace safety, health hazards, environmental programs, and methods of reducing and/or eliminating workplace hazards as directed by the EHS Manager. Maintains SDS Inventory by conducting chemical audits of department areas, working with team members to ensure new SDS are incorporated into the system, and updating SDS resources in the appropriate web-based software program. Supports safety initiative programs by maintaining accountability information for site safety initiative programs, updating roster, and communicating with teams to ensure employees know the status. Also, participates in the safety committee and other potential committee assignments as needed. Be prepared to lead safety committee meetings in the EHS Manager's absence. Develops and supports site safety and environmental programs by working closely with the EHS Manager to address various safety and environmental compliance requirements including but not limited to monitoring regulatory changes, program development, site inspections, and ongoing monitoring and reporting requirements. Safety Programs may include PPE, Fall Protection, Forklift, Lock-Out Tag-Out, Machine Guarding, Respiratory Protection, Hearing Conservation, and others. Environmental programs may consist of stormwater, air permitting, universal, non-hazardous, and hazardous waste. Support production team by taking a proactive approach to support production. Assist department supervisors with incident investigations, equipment relocation, delivery of training, conducting audits, following up on safety work orders, and providing labels as needed. Provide support to ensure worker safety by assisting the EHS Manager in maintaining worker safety at both the Metals and Rotational Molding facilities. Conduct periodic safety inspections and interface with employees as needed to ensure compliance with safety policies. Promote safety awareness through the posting of safety bulletins and signs. Assist in the implementation of safety policy as directed by the EHS Manager. Conducts audits and inspections by conducting periodic location inspections regarding housekeeping, equipment and machinery condition, environmental concerns, DOT records, and all other safety-related issues at locations to ensure compliance with all applicable regulations. Maintains documents by keeping accurate records of all required audits, inspections, and related compliance tracking requirements as needed. This may include but is not limited to air emissions tracking, wastewater, training, hazardous waste tracking, internal tracking. Supports facility improvements projects by Participating in facility improvement projects by researching requirements, suggesting options, and evaluating safety and environmental compliance issues. Maintains professional knowledge by attending educational seminars, conferences, workshops, and meetings when required. Obtaining certificates, licenses, and registrations as needed. Contributes to team effort by accomplishing all necessary tasks and elements of the specific job function and supporting all other company personnel and departments whenever necessary. Maintains compliance to the environmental standard by complying with procedures, rules, and regulations.Qualified applicants will have:
Must have an Associate degree (A.A.) or equivalent from a two-year college or technical school; or minimum two years related experience and or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ience. Knowledge of and experience with quality managementISO 14001
2015 systems and practices is preferred. Must be computer and Microsoft office technology literate. Must be proficient with Microsoft Outlook, Word, PowerPoint, Excel, and Microsoft Teams. Experience with SharePoint and Microsoft Power Platform is preferred. Must be proficient in utilizing Internet Explorer for research. Minimum of two (2) years EHS experience in a manufacturing environment is preferred. Practices and a proven record of Professional Development is preferred. Must have good organizational skills and be able to prioritize responsibilities. Must communicate well with co-workers, senior staff members, vendors, and all internal customers. Must be able to work as an integral member in a team environment. Must be able to exhibit a coaching style of leadership to enhance working relationships with co-workers. A written/oral examination may be a requirement to assess the ability to meet job duty requirements. Bilingual (English and Spanish) language skills preferred.
